It's all upwind on the nose so you'll be powering - that's why people
love the SD to PV trip and hate the PV to SD trip - it's known as the Baja Bash. On 21 Oct 2003 15:14:42 -0700, (John Skiffington) wrote: Greetings to all. Can someone tell me where I should look to discover info as to how long it would take to sail a 40' boat from Puerto Vallarta to San Diego? I understand winds, currents, weather, etc, all play a factor-- but where do I start? Thanks. John Skiffington Simi Valley, CA |
